Transaction 99095c50386f3a63c64533f8b6a784c77cd6e79782856bd016cfdc28518b5949
1 Input
1 Output
-
99095c50386f3a63c64533f8b6a784c77cd6e79782856bd016cfdc28518b5949:0
- value
- 538186
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7cab231c1d4c7472f8f8b3b7e1f8b32c7adb5b61 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CNBoc4PrdL94vTAjybtQY3TPU4qYuvhTr